Output 804a9059829202ee3503ec2d412e1fbe05d7e86c5ae1acaf49aa10c05edcf34f:1

value
3636102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 446127192ae21e5413ea70ebf0efe6f92f76fe28 OP_EQUAL
address
37vaFst9Jm3Jh8nP4eSXfv592a4Ut1WpJB
transaction
804a9059829202ee3503ec2d412e1fbe05d7e86c5ae1acaf49aa10c05edcf34f